Bug#644174: Probable cause of freeze of Dell Vostro 3750, when booting with device connected to USB 3.0 jack
I have found some facts which hopefully may explain the problems with booting of Dell Vostro 3750. 1. The system hangs, when it attempts to service cooling devices controlled via SMBus 2. The SMBus controller and the USB 3.0 controller share the same IRQ 18 line (is it a standard solution or design flaw?) 3. The interrupt service routine in the i2c-smbus.c driver seems not to support shared interrupts. Bug#661887: mxml: Bad control character error when attempting to load banks
Package: zynaddsubfx Version: 2.4.0-1.2 Followup-For: Bug #661887 Dear Maintainer, I experience the same situation on my system. To investigate the problem, I have run zynaddsubfx via strace: strace -ff -o log zynaddsubfx That's what I've found in one of the logs, after I tried to select one of banks open(/usr/share/zynaddsubfx/banks/William_Godfrey_Collection//0045-Hard Stereo Sweep Synth.xiz, O_RDONLY) = 7 fstat64(7, {st_mode=S_IFREG|0644, st_size=2860, ...}) = 0 mmap2(NULL, 4096, PROT_READ|PROT_WRITE, MAP_PRIVATE|MAP_ANONYMOUS, -1, 0) = 0xb0059000 fstat64(7, {st_mode=S_IFREG|0644, st_size=2860, ...}) = 0 _llseek(7, 0, [0], SEEK_SET)= 0 read(7, \37\213\10\0\0\0\0\0\0\3\355\\Qs\3338\16~\357\257\360\371\275\353\310\211c{\246\355\216/..., 2860) = 2860 _llseek(7, 2860, [2860], SEEK_SET) = 0 close(7)= 0 munmap(0xb0059000, 4096)= 0 write(2, mxml: Bad control character 0x1f..., 62) = 62 When I opened the /usr/share/zynaddsubfx/banks/William_Godfrey_Collection//0045-Hard Stereo Sweep Synth.xiz without decompression, I can see, that indeed the first byte is 0x1f However if I rename it e.g. to test.gz and perform gzip -d test.gz, I can see correct XML file. Bug#578159: RFP: pencil -- Pencil - Traditional animation software
Package: wnpp Severity: wishlist *** Please type your report below this line *** Package name: pencil Version : 0.4.4b Upstream Author : ??? URL : http://pencil-animation.org/ License : GPL Programming Lang: C++ Description : Pencil - Traditional animation software Pencil is an animation/drawing software for Mac OS X, Windows, and Linux. It lets you create traditional hand-drawn animation (cartoon) using both bitmap and vector graphics.
